How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Boulder County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Boulder County Studio Apartments | $1,938 | $1,159 | $3,123 |
| Boulder County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,078 | $847 | $6,742 |
| Boulder County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,387 | $870 | $10,000+ |
| Boulder County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,912 | $975 | $7,166 |
| Boulder County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,750 | $1,205 | $6,680 |
| Boulder County 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,250 | $5,000 | $5,500 |
